+7 (499) 677-64-37

Скопировать

Портирование игр, разработанных на unity, на разные платформы

Портирование игр, разработанных на unity, на разные платформы

Время чтения: 3 минут
Просмотров: 6096

Портирование игр, разработанных на популярном игровом движке Unity, является актуальной темой для разработчиков и издателей. Каждая игровая платформа имеет свои особенности и требования к аппаратному обеспечению, что создает необходимость в адаптации игры под разные устройства.

Unity предоставляет разработчикам универсальный инструмент для создания игр, однако для успешного портирования на разные платформы необходимо учитывать различия в архитектуре и возможностях устройств. Некоторые платформы могут требовать оптимизации графики, управления или функционала игры.

Портирование игры на разные платформы также открывает дополнительные возможности для монетизации и расширения аудитории. Адаптация игры под мобильные устройства, игровые консоли или виртуальную реальность позволяет достигнуть новых пользователей и увеличить прибыль от проекта.

Портирование игр, разработанных на unity, на разные платформы

Unity – один из самых популярных игровых движков, который позволяет создавать качественные игры для различных платформ, включая ПК, мобильные устройства, консоли и виртуальную реальность. Однако, разработчики часто сталкиваются с необходимостью портирования игр на разные платформы. В этой статье мы рассмотрим процесс портирования игр, разработанных на unity, на различные платформы и оптимизации этого процесса с точки зрения поисковой оптимизации.

Первым шагом в портировании игр на разные платформы является анализ целевой аудитории и выбор подходящих платформ. Например, если игра разработана для ПК, то портирование на мобильные устройства может потребовать оптимизации управления и интерфейса.

Следующим шагом является адаптация игрового контента под требования выбранных платформ. Это может включать в себя оптимизацию графики, звука, управления, а также другие технические аспекты. Важно учитывать ограничения каждой платформы, чтобы обеспечить оптимальную производительность игры.

Для портирования игр на мобильные устройства, кроме технических аспектов, необходимо также учитывать особенности мобильных платформ, включая разные разрешения экранов, процессоры и операционные системы. Также важно провести тестирование игры на разных устройствах, чтобы обеспечить ее работоспособность и оптимальное качество.

Одним из ключевых аспектов успешного портирования игр на разные платформы является оптимизация процесса разработки и тестирования. Для этого разработчики могут использовать специальные инструменты и технологии, такие как Unity Cloud Build, которые позволяют автоматизировать процесс сборки и тестирования игры на разных платформах.

Кроме того, важно учитывать требования поисковых систем при портировании игр на разные платформы. Для достижения оптимальной видимости игры в поисковых результатах различных платформ, необходимо уделять внимание аспектам поисковой оптимизации.

Для улучшения поисковой оптимизации игры на разных платформах, разработчики могут использовать следующие методы:

- Оптимизация метаданных игры, включая название, описание, ключевые слова и изображения для каждой платформы;

- Улучшение производительности и оптимизация игрового контента под требования поисковых систем;

- Создание уникального контента для каждой платформы, чтобы обеспечить уникальный опыт игры;

- Разработка маркетинговой стратегии, ориентированной на каждую платформу, включая использование рекламы, социальных сетей и других каналов продвижения.

В заключение, портирование игр, разработанных на unity, на различные платформы является важным этапом в расширении аудитории и достижении новых рынков. Для успешного портирования игр на разные платформы необходимо учитывать технические аспекты, особенности каждой платформы, а также придерживаться аспектов поисковой оптимизации, чтобы обеспечить оптимальное качество игры и ее видимость в поисковых системах.

Портирование игр на различные платформы – это важный этап в развитии проекта, который позволяет игрокам на разных устройствах насладиться игровым процессом.

- Неизвестный автор

Название игры Платформа Дата портирования
Angry Birds 2 iOS 27 апреля 2015
Subway Surfers Android 2012
Temple Run 2 Windows Phone 19 декабря 2013
Cut the Rope PlayStation 3 22 апреля 2011
Assassin's Creed: Линейка судьбы Nintendo Switch 21 мая 2021
Minecraft Xbox One 5 сентября 2014

Основные проблемы по теме "Портирование игр, разработанных на unity, на разные платформы"

1. Совместимость с аппаратным обеспечением

При портировании игр на разные платформы возникают проблемы со совместимостью с различным аппаратным обеспечением. Разные устройства имеют разные характеристики, что может привести к ошибкам и проблемам в работе игры. Необходимо проводить тщательное тестирование на каждой целевой платформе и вносить соответствующие изменения для обеспечения совместимости.

2. Оптимизация производительности

Еще одной проблемой при портировании игр на разные платформы является оптимизация производительности. Различные платформы имеют разные возможности по обработке графики, звука и других ресурсов. При портировании необходимо учитывать эти особенности и проводить оптимизацию игры для каждой платформы, чтобы обеспечить плавный игровой процесс и избежать проблем с производительностью.

3. Управление вводом

Еще одной проблемой при портировании игр на разные платформы является управление вводом. Разные устройства имеют разные способы ввода данных, такие как клавиатура, мышь, геймпад, сенсорный экран и другие. Необходимо предусмотреть возможность адаптации управления под каждую целевую платформу, чтобы обеспечить комфортный геймплей для игроков.

Какие платформы поддерживает портирование игр, разработанных на Unity?

Unity поддерживает портирование на различные платформы, включая iOS, Android, Windows, Mac, Linux, Xbox, PlayStation, Nintendo Switch и другие.

Какие аспекты разработки игр нужно учитывать при портировании на разные платформы?

При портировании игр на разные платформы необходимо учитывать различия в аппаратных возможностях, управлении, экранах, а также требованиях к производительности и оптимизации.

Могут ли возникнуть проблемы при портировании игр на различные платформы?

Да, при портировании игр на разные платформы могут возникнуть проблемы совместимости, оптимизации, управлением и интерфейсом, требующие дополнительной работы и тестирования.

Материал подготовлен командой app-android.ru

Читать ещё

Как подключить геймпад к Айфону
В этой статье мы расскажем, как настроить геймпад на айфоне за пару минут, и ответим на возможные вопросы.
Приложения для диагностики Android
При покупке телефона у многих пользователей возникает интерес: «Насколько мощно работает гаджет?»
Применение принципов Continuous Integration (CI) и Continuous Deployment (CD) в Android-разработке
Современная разработка под Android